Transaction 104af5794045fe833ba345705abfcf369d6ba585bf7e12bbf97a88d567385a1a
1 Input
2 Outputs
- 104af5794045fe833ba345705abfcf369d6ba585bf7e12bbf97a88d567385a1a:0
- 104af5794045fe833ba345705abfcf369d6ba585bf7e12bbf97a88d567385a1a:1
value 26898
address 1GgJg66hGzFBJ4k5QQEzz3bGpXy3XqojqS
value 800098
address 1EaiYQa7yyJBBdvB4dn6FLUBNtjPeCBWaC